## Who to Contact: DeployBeacon Bot

DeployBeacon posts deploy status into chat channels and exposes a plugin hook API for external authors. For questions about hook signatures, rate limits, or schema changes, consult the integration guide first. Breaking API changes are announced two weeks ahead. If your plugin stops receiving status events or you need a sandbox token, write to the maintainers at the address below.

escalation mailbox, yafog-kafof: eliok@xolmarcloud.local

Quarterly Planning Note — Divestiture of the Coastal Tooling Unit

For the finance team: the sale of the Coastal Tooling unit to Pellmark Industries remains on track for close in Q3. Please finalize the carve-out balance sheet, reconcile intercompany positions, and prepare the working-capital adjustment schedule by month-end. Audit support requests should be prioritized. For planning purposes, note the following sensitive item:

internal memo for hawef-kahif: The finance team signed off on a budget of $25.9 million for Project Sorox. The renewal with Pelokek Logistics closes at $51.7 million a year, 52 percent below the last contract.

We have since introduced exponential backoff with jitter, a per-endpoint circuit breaker, and a dead-letter queue after the final attempt. New team members modifying delivery logic must keep these mechanisms intact and update the runbook if values change. Ownership sits with the Tollbridge integrations squad. The constants currently in production are shown below.

constants for kageg-bawif:
QUOTAS = {
    "quenwyn": 1,
    "oliix": 10,
}

Ticket: Gridlock admin table — bulk edits blocked. The Quillhaven vault auto-locked after three failed unseal attempts, so bulk edit mode in the Ferntide admin table is read-only. Don't retry unseal; you'll extend the lockout. Scope: affects row-level status flags only. Fix: unlock the vault, then rerun the pending bulk job from the queue. As the new contractor, use the recovery passphrase below to unseal.

unlock words, hahip-baduf: holwyn-istath-julvan